 | #include <stdio.h> | 
 | #include "internal/cryptlib.h" | 
 | #include <openssl/safestack.h> | 
 | #include <openssl/asn1.h> | 
 | #include <openssl/objects.h> | 
 | #include <openssl/evp.h> | 
 | #include <openssl/x509.h> | 
 | #include <openssl/x509v3.h> | 
 | #include "x509_local.h" | 
 |  | 
 | int X509v3_get_ext_count(const STACK_OF(X509_EXTENSION) *x) | 
 | { | 
 |     if (x == NULL) | 
 |         return 0; | 
 |     return sk_X509_EXTENSION_num(x); | 
 | } | 
 |  | 
 | int X509v3_get_ext_by_NID(const STACK_OF(X509_EXTENSION) *x, int nid, | 
 |                           int lastpos) | 
 | { | 
 |     ASN1_OBJECT *obj; | 
 |  | 
 |     obj = OBJ_nid2obj(nid); | 
 |     if (obj == NULL) | 
 |         return -2; | 
 |     return X509v3_get_ext_by_OBJ(x, obj, lastpos); | 
 | } | 
 |  | 
 | int X509v3_get_ext_by_OBJ(const STACK_OF(X509_EXTENSION) *sk, | 
 |                           const ASN1_OBJECT *obj, int lastpos) | 
 | { | 
 |     int n; | 
 |     X509_EXTENSION *ex; | 
 |  | 
 |     if (sk == NULL) | 
 |         return -1; | 
 |     lastpos++; | 
 |     if (lastpos < 0) | 
 |         lastpos = 0; | 
 |     n = sk_X509_EXTENSION_num(sk); | 
 |     for (; lastpos < n; lastpos++) { | 
 |         ex = sk_X509_EXTENSION_value(sk, lastpos); | 
 |         if (OBJ_cmp(ex->object, obj) == 0) | 
 |             return lastpos; | 
 |     } | 
 |     return -1; | 
 | } | 
 |  | 
 | int X509v3_get_ext_by_critical(const STACK_OF(X509_EXTENSION) *sk, int crit, | 
 |                                int lastpos) | 
 | { | 
 |     int n; | 
 |     X509_EXTENSION *ex; | 
 |  | 
 |     if (sk == NULL) | 
 |         return -1; | 
 |     lastpos++; | 
 |     if (lastpos < 0) | 
 |         lastpos = 0; | 
 |     n = sk_X509_EXTENSION_num(sk); | 
 |     for (; lastpos < n; lastpos++) { | 
 |         ex = sk_X509_EXTENSION_value(sk, lastpos); | 
 |         if (((ex->critical > 0) && crit) || ((ex->critical <= 0) && !crit)) | 
 |             return lastpos; | 
 |     } | 
 |     return -1; | 
 | } | 
 |  | 
 | X509_EXTENSION *X509v3_get_ext(const STACK_OF(X509_EXTENSION) *x, int loc) | 
 | { | 
 |     if (x == NULL || sk_X509_EXTENSION_num(x) <= loc || loc < 0) | 
 |         return NULL; | 
 |     else | 
 |         return sk_X509_EXTENSION_value(x, loc); | 
 | } | 
 |  | 
 | X509_EXTENSION *X509v3_delete_ext(STACK_OF(X509_EXTENSION) *x, int loc) | 
 | { | 
 |     X509_EXTENSION *ret; | 
 |  | 
 |     if (x == NULL || sk_X509_EXTENSION_num(x) <= loc || loc < 0) | 
 |         return NULL; | 
 |     ret = sk_X509_EXTENSION_delete(x, loc); | 
 |     return ret; | 
 | } | 
 |  | 
 | STACK_OF(X509_EXTENSION) *X509v3_add_ext(STACK_OF(X509_EXTENSION) **x, | 
 |                                          X509_EXTENSION *ex, int loc) | 
 | { | 
 |     X509_EXTENSION *new_ex = NULL; | 
 |     int n; | 
 |     STACK_OF(X509_EXTENSION) *sk = NULL; | 
 |  | 
 |     if (x == NULL) { | 
 |         ERR_raise(ERR_LIB_X509, ERR_R_PASSED_NULL_PARAMETER); | 
 |         goto err2; | 
 |     } | 
 |  | 
 |     if (*x == NULL) { | 
 |         if ((sk = sk_X509_EXTENSION_new_null()) == NULL) | 
 |             goto err; | 
 |     } else | 
 |         sk = *x; | 
 |  | 
 |     n = sk_X509_EXTENSION_num(sk); | 
 |     if (loc > n) | 
 |         loc = n; | 
 |     else if (loc < 0) | 
 |         loc = n; | 
 |  | 
 |     if ((new_ex = X509_EXTENSION_dup(ex)) == NULL) | 
 |         goto err2; | 
 |     if (!sk_X509_EXTENSION_insert(sk, new_ex, loc)) | 
 |         goto err; | 
 |     if (*x == NULL) | 
 |         *x = sk; | 
 |     return sk; | 
 |  err: | 
 |     ERR_raise(ERR_LIB_X509, ERR_R_MALLOC_FAILURE); | 
 |  err2: | 
 |     X509_EXTENSION_free(new_ex); | 
 |     if (x != NULL && *x == NULL) | 
 |         sk_X509_EXTENSION_free(sk); | 
 |     return NULL; | 
 | } | 
 |  | 
 | X509_EXTENSION *X509_EXTENSION_create_by_NID(X509_EXTENSION **ex, int nid, | 
 |                                              int crit, | 
 |                                              ASN1_OCTET_STRING *data) | 
 | { | 
 |     ASN1_OBJECT *obj; | 
 |     X509_EXTENSION *ret; | 
 |  | 
 |     obj = OBJ_nid2obj(nid); | 
 |     if (obj == NULL) { | 
 |         ERR_raise(ERR_LIB_X509, X509_R_UNKNOWN_NID); | 
 |         return NULL; | 
 |     } | 
 |     ret = X509_EXTENSION_create_by_OBJ(ex, obj, crit, data); | 
 |     if (ret == NULL) | 
 |         ASN1_OBJECT_free(obj); | 
 |     return ret; | 
 | } | 
 |  | 
 | X509_EXTENSION *X509_EXTENSION_create_by_OBJ(X509_EXTENSION **ex, | 
 |                                              const ASN1_OBJECT *obj, int crit, | 
 |                                              ASN1_OCTET_STRING *data) | 
 | { | 
 |     X509_EXTENSION *ret; | 
 |  | 
 |     if ((ex == NULL) || (*ex == NULL)) { | 
 |         if ((ret = X509_EXTENSION_new()) == NULL) { | 
 |             ERR_raise(ERR_LIB_X509, ERR_R_MALLOC_FAILURE); | 
 |             return NULL; | 
 |         } | 
 |     } else | 
 |         ret = *ex; | 
 |  | 
 |     if (!X509_EXTENSION_set_object(ret, obj)) | 
 |         goto err; | 
 |     if (!X509_EXTENSION_set_critical(ret, crit)) | 
 |         goto err; | 
 |     if (!X509_EXTENSION_set_data(ret, data)) | 
 |         goto err; | 
 |  | 
 |     if ((ex != NULL) && (*ex == NULL)) | 
 |         *ex = ret; | 
 |     return ret; | 
 |  err: | 
 |     if ((ex == NULL) || (ret != *ex)) | 
 |         X509_EXTENSION_free(ret); | 
 |     return NULL; | 
 | } | 
 |  | 
 | int X509_EXTENSION_set_object(X509_EXTENSION *ex, const ASN1_OBJECT *obj) | 
 | { | 
 |     if ((ex == NULL) || (obj == NULL)) | 
 |         return 0; | 
 |     ASN1_OBJECT_free(ex->object); | 
 |     ex->object = OBJ_dup(obj); | 
 |     return ex->object != NULL; | 
 | } | 
 |  | 
 | int X509_EXTENSION_set_critical(X509_EXTENSION *ex, int crit) | 
 | { | 
 |     if (ex == NULL) | 
 |         return 0; | 
 |     ex->critical = (crit) ? 0xFF : -1; | 
 |     return 1; | 
 | } | 
 |  | 
 | int X509_EXTENSION_set_data(X509_EXTENSION *ex, ASN1_OCTET_STRING *data) | 
 | { | 
 |     int i; | 
 |  | 
 |     if (ex == NULL) | 
 |         return 0; | 
 |     i = ASN1_OCTET_STRING_set(&ex->value, data->data, data->length); | 
 |     if (!i) | 
 |         return 0; | 
 |     return 1; | 
 | } | 
 |  | 
 | ASN1_OBJECT *X509_EXTENSION_get_object(X509_EXTENSION *ex) | 
 | { | 
 |     if (ex == NULL) | 
 |         return NULL; | 
 |     return ex->object; | 
 | } | 
 |  | 
 | ASN1_OCTET_STRING *X509_EXTENSION_get_data(X509_EXTENSION *ex) | 
 | { | 
 |     if (ex == NULL) | 
 |         return NULL; | 
 |     return &ex->value; | 
 | } | 
 |  | 
 | int X509_EXTENSION_get_critical(const X509_EXTENSION *ex) | 
 | { | 
 |     if (ex == NULL) | 
 |         return 0; | 
 |     if (ex->critical > 0) | 
 |         return 1; | 
 |     return 0; | 
 | } |
